我的代理服务器是什么
-
代理服务器(Proxy server)是一种位于客户端与目标服务器之间的中间服务器,它充当了客户端与目标服务器之间的中转站。它的作用是代理客户端向目标服务器发送请求,并将目标服务器返回的响应转发给客户端。
代理服务器的主要功能有以下几点:
- 缓存功能:代理服务器在接收到客户端的请求后,会先检查是否有与之匹配的缓存文件。如果有,代理服务器会直接将缓存文件返回给客户端,减少了对目标服务器的请求,提高了访问速度。
- 访问控制功能:代理服务器可以根据配置对客户端的请求进行访问控制,可以限制某些特定客户端的访问,也可以限制某些特定资源的访问。
- 隐藏真实IP地址:当客户端通过代理服务器发送请求时,目标服务器只能看到代理服务器的IP地址,无法获取到客户端的真实IP地址,可以实现匿名访问的效果。
- 加密功能:代理服务器可以对客户端与目标服务器之间的通信进行加密处理,保护数据的安全性。
- 负载均衡功能:当代理服务器接收到多个客户端的请求时,可以根据配置将请求均衡地分发给多台目标服务器,提高系统的负载能力和稳定性。
总的来说,代理服务器提供了一种安全、高效的网络访问方式,可以帮助客户端提高访问速度、保护个人隐私、实现网络资源的共享与管理等功能。
1年前 -
代理服务器(Proxy Server)是一种位于客户端和目标服务器之间的网络服务器,用于转发客户端请求并代替客户端向目标服务器发起请求。通过使用代理服务器,可以在客户端和目标服务器之间建立一个中间层,实现以下功能:
-
匿名访问:代理服务器可以隐藏客户端的真实IP地址,保护客户端的隐私和安全。当客户端向目标服务器发起请求时,目标服务器只能看到代理服务器的IP地址,而无法追溯到客户端。
-
访问控制:代理服务器可以根据配置文件中的规则,对客户端的请求进行筛选和过滤。可以设置黑名单和白名单,限制对某些特定网站的访问。同时,代理服务器也可以设置访问权限,只允许特定的客户端进行访问。
-
缓存服务:代理服务器可以缓存已经访问过的网页内容,当下次有相同的请求时,可以直接从缓存中获取,提高网页访问速度。特别是对于频繁访问的网页,可以大大减少网络带宽的使用。
-
加密通信:代理服务器可以通过SSL/TLS等加密协议对客户端和目标服务器之间的数据进行加密,保护数据的安全性。尤其是在使用公共Wi-Fi等不安全网络时,代理服务器可以提供额外的安全保护。
-
流量控制:代理服务器可以对客户端和目标服务器之间的网络流量进行控制和管理。可以限制每个客户端的带宽使用,防止某个客户端占用过多的网络资源。同时,代理服务器也可以利用缓存和压缩技术来减少网络流量的消耗,提高网络的效率。
总结来说,代理服务器是一个位于客户端和目标服务器之间的网络服务器,可以提供匿名访问、访问控制、缓存服务、加密通信和流量控制等功能。通过使用代理服务器,可以改善网络安全、提高访问速度和有效利用网络资源。
1年前 -
-
代理服务器(Proxy Server)是位于客户端和目标服务器之间的中间服务器,用来转发客户端请求并代理客户端与目标服务器进行通信。代理服务器的作用主要有三个方面:
-
隐藏真实IP地址:代理服务器可以隐藏客户端的真实IP地址,从而保护客户端的隐私和安全。当客户端向目标服务器发送请求时,目标服务器只能看到代理服务器的IP地址,无法直接获取到客户端的真实IP地址。
-
缓存网络资源:代理服务器可以缓存一些常用的网络资源,例如网页、图片、视频等,当其他客户端请求相同的资源时,代理服务器可以直接返回缓存的资源,减少网络流量和提高访问速度。
-
过滤和限制网络访问:代理服务器可以根据配置规则,对客户端的请求进行过滤和限制,例如阻止访问某些特定的网站、限制特定IP地址的访问等,从而实现网络访问的管控和安全防护。
下面将介绍代理服务器的设置和使用方法。根据不同操作系统和需求,代理服务器的设置方法可能有所差异。
Windows 系统设置代理服务器
在 Windows 系统中,可以通过以下步骤设置代理服务器:
-
打开控制面板,并选择“网络和 Internet”选项。
-
在“网络和 Internet”选项中,选择“Internet 选项”。
-
在 Internet 选项窗口中,选择“连接”选项卡。
-
在连接选项卡中,点击“局域网设置”。
-
在局域网设置窗口中,勾选“代理服务器”复选框。
-
输入代理服务器的地址和端口号,并点击“确定”保存设置。
设置完成后,系统中的应用程序和浏览器都会使用代理服务器进行网络访问。
Mac 系统设置代理服务器
在 Mac 系统中,可以通过以下步骤设置代理服务器:
-
点击屏幕左上角的苹果图标,选择“系统偏好设置”。
-
在系统偏好设置窗口中,选择“网络”。
-
在网络选项中,选择当前使用的网络连接,点击“高级”。
-
在高级选项窗口中,选择“代理”。
-
在代理选项中,选择“网页代理(HTTP)”或“安全网页代理(HTTPS)”,根据需要填写代理服务器的地址和端口号。
-
点击“确定”保存设置。
Linux 系统设置代理服务器
在 Linux 系统中,可以通过修改网络配置文件的方式设置代理服务器。具体的操作步骤因系统版本和发行版而有所差异,以下是一个示例:
-
使用 root 用户登录系统。
-
打开终端窗口,并使用文本编辑器打开 "/etc/environment" 文件。
-
在文件中添加以下行,配置代理服务器地址和端口号:
http_proxy="http://代理服务器地址:端口号" https_proxy="http://代理服务器地址:端口号" ftp_proxy="http://代理服务器地址:端口号"-
保存文件并退出文本编辑器。
-
更新配置文件,使之生效:
source /etc/environment浏览器设置代理服务器
除了在操作系统中设置代理服务器外,还可以在浏览器中单独设置代理服务器。
以下是在常见浏览器中设置代理服务器的方法:
Google Chrome
-
打开 Chrome 浏览器,在地址栏中输入 "chrome://settings" 并按下回车。
-
在设置页面中,点击左侧的“高级”选项。
-
在高级选项中,点击“系统”。
-
在系统设置中,点击“打开您的计算机的代理设置”。
-
在系统代理设置中,可以选择自动获取代理设置,或手动输入代理服务器的地址和端口号。
Mozilla Firefox
-
打开 Firefox 浏览器,在地址栏中输入 "about:preferences" 并按下回车。
-
在首选项页面中,选择“高级”选项卡。
-
在高级选项中,点击“网络”选项卡。
-
在连接部分的“设置”中,选择“手动代理配置”。
-
输入代理服务器的地址和端口号,并选择相应的代理类型。
设置完成后,浏览器将会使用代理服务器进行网络访问。
以上是代理服务器的设置和使用方法,根据不同的操作系统和需求,可能会有所差异。根据实际情况选择适合的设置方式,并注意代理服务器的安全性和可靠性。
1年前 -